Tesla Key Hand Implant
Ben Workman, a man from Utah was tired of using an actual key fob or smartphone to unlock his Tesla. So, he decided to surgically implant the key directly into his hand, thus enabling him to simply wave to unlock his vehicle. That was just the start, as now he can unlock his car, work doors, log on / off the computer and share contact information by simply waving.



Not only will he never forget his car keys again, but he likes to have some fun with the implant, as he plays tricks on people who don’t the implant is in his hand. How so? He tries t o convince them a banana is the key and then holds it up and magically the door unlocks. What’s next for Ben? He wants to find a way to integrate Apple Pay / Android Pay into his hand.
